Speaker Bio
Dr. Wendy Bohon is a geologist who studies earthquakes and works to improve the communication of science. Dr. Bohon has a BA in Theatre and Geology from James Madison University, a MSc in Geology from Ohio State University and a PhD in Earthquake Geology from Arizona State University.
Currently, she serves as the Branch Chief of Seismic Hazards & Earthquake Engineering for the California Geological Survey. In the past, she has worked as the Strategic Communication Specialist at NASA Goddard, the Education and Outreach Coordinator for the USGS Earthquake Hazards Program, and the Senior Science Communication Specialist for the Incorporated Research Institutions for Seismology. She also founded the Science Communication consulting companies Dr. Wendy Rocks, LLC, and SpaceFace Social Media.
